为对预应力组合箱梁的设计提供参考,利用简化塑性理论对完全剪力连接的预应力组合梁的抗弯承载力影响参数(混凝土和钢梁强度、预应力筋初始张拉力、预应力筋布筋形式、转向块数量)进行分析。分析结果表明:在截面尺寸受限制时,提高钢梁强度能够有效提高预应力组合梁的抗弯承载力;增加预应力筋的数量可较明显地提高梁体的抗弯承载力;预应力筋采用折线布筋形式时,可提高预应力初始张拉值,以提高预应力组合梁的弹性承载力;转向块布置数量越多,预应力增量越大,二次效应影响越小,预应力组合梁抗弯承载力越高。 相似文献

智能网联汽车测试场设计需要将传统道路工程与新兴智慧交通工程深度融合,兼顾道路基础设施与智慧交通设施设计要求,引入互联网企业迭代与共享思维,提出测试相对集中、柔性可控可测、专用共享统筹、标准适度超前的基本设计理论,并结合国内外多个测试场地情况,进行了完整解析. 相似文献

A method is described which is an extension of rolling contact models with respect to plasticity. This new method, which is an extension of the STRIPES semi-Hertzian (SH) model, has been implemented in a multi-body-system (MBS) package and does not result in a longer execution time than the STRIPES SH model [J.B. Ayasse and H. Chollet, Determination of the wheel–rail contact patch in semi-Hertzian conditions, Veh. Syst. Dyn. 43(3) (2005), pp. 161–172]. High speed of computation is obtained by some hypotheses about the plastic law, the shape of stresses, the locus of the maximum stress and the slip. Plasticity does not change the vehicle behaviour but there is a need for an extension of rolling contact models with respect to plasticity as far as fatigue analysis of rail is concerned: rolling contact fatigue may be addressed via the finite element method (FEM) including material non-linearities, where loads are the contact stresses provided by the post-processing of MBS results [K. Dang Van, M.H. Maitournam, Z. Moumni, and F. Roger, A comprehensive approach for modeling fatigue and fracture of rails, Eng. Fract. Mech. 76 (2009), pp. 2626–2636]. In STRIPES, like in other MBS models, contact stresses may exceed the plastic yield criterion, leading to wrong results in the subsequent FEM analysis. With the proposed method, contact stresses are kept consistent with a perfect plastic law, avoiding these problems. The method is benchmarked versus non-linear FEM in Hertzian geometries. As a consequence of taking plasticity into account, contact patch area is bigger than the elastic one. In accordance with FEM results, a different ellipse aspect ratio than the one predicted by Hertz theory was also found and finally pressure does not exceed the threshold prescribed by the plastic law. The method also provides more exact results with non-Hertzian geometries. The new approach is finally compared with non-linear FEM in a tangent case with a unidirectional load and a complete slip: when plasticity is taken into account, and for large adhesion values, friction forces have an influence on the size of the contact patch. The proposed approach enables also to assess extensively the level of plasticity along a track through an indicator associated with a given yield stress. 相似文献

针对传统自底向上设计模式效率低的问题,研究基于三维CAD协同设计环境,借助公理设计理论(AD理论)的评审准则,构建模型数据层次构架;采用发明问题解决理论(TRIZ理论)的矛盾解决原理,协调模型构建过程冲突问题,从而建立协同环境下城市客车自顶向下设计的运行模式。为企业缩短产品开发时间,提升零部件通用性提供理论及实践参考。 相似文献

Abstract This paper examines the causal relationship between economic growth and domestic air passenger transport in Brazil, using Granger's causality test. Total domestic passenger-kilometres are used as a proxy for air transport demand and gross domestic product as a proxy for economic growth. The test spans the period from 1966 to 2006. The results lead to the acceptance of the hypothesis that there is a unidirectional Granger causal relationship from economic growth to domestic air transport demand in Brazil, having a high elasticity in the short term. 相似文献
